gcli developer toolbar: buttons in output don't work (arg.text.toLowerCase is not a function)

Latest Nightly and Aurora (both 20140503) on Windows 8.1 When opening the developer toolbar and typing |help| and trying to click a button, or typing |help eyedropper| and trying to click the button, nothing happens. From the error console: Fehler: arg.text.toLowerCase is not a function Quelldatei: resource://gre/modules/commonjs/toolkit/loader.js -> resource://gre/modules/devtools/gcli/types/command.js Zeile: 121
